Innholdsfortegnelse:
Video: Ordklokke ved hjelp av Arduino og RTC: 7 trinn (med bilder)
2024 Forfatter: John Day | [email protected]. Sist endret: 2024-01-30 11:24
Jeg bestemte meg for å lage en spesiell gave til kjæresten min til bursdagen hennes. Ettersom vi begge liker elektronikk, var det en god idé å lage noe "elektronikk". Dessuten har vi begge gitt hverandre denne typen selvlagde gaver før, og det føles bare fantastisk.
Så jeg surfet bare på YouTube, og jeg kom over en video. Etter å ha sett det var jeg ganske sikker på at jeg kommer til å lage dette. Slik begynte det hele.
Jeg undersøkte internett for flere slike opplæringsprogrammer, men ingenting passet mine behov. Mine krav var: 1. Enkel konstruksjon av huset for alle delene å holde i. 2. Kontrolleren som brukes må være Arduino.3. For å beholde en sanntidsklokke må du bruke 4. Lysdiodene som brukes må være WS2812B.
Jeg så på flere opplæringsprogrammer, og bestemte meg for å slå dem sammen for å lage en ordklokke i henhold til mine krav. Det er mange ordklokkeopplæringer på internett, og jeg bestemte meg for å dele min skapelse fordi ingen av dem er av denne typen. Det er også enkelt å bygge en pengevennlig.
Opplæringsprogrammene jeg refererte til er listet opp nedenfor.
1. Super Lag noe
2. Jeremy Blum
3. Scott Bezek
Så, la oss komme i gang.
Trinn 1: Deler påkrevd
Dette er hjertet i prosjektet. Du gjør det riktig, alt vil se bra ut.
Jeg valgte hardboard for å være basen da den er lett å jobbe med (lage hull og kutte), den er vanskelig og lett tilgjengelig. Så gå og hent en 9 x 9 tommers hardboard. Før du gjør noe, må du kontrollere om det passer i trekassen. Hvis ikke, juster det ved å arkivere eller kutte det og gjøre det slik at det er enkelt å fjerne og sette det i esken.
Etter at det er gjort, opprett en mal i Inkscape ved å bruke vinyldesign som base. Merk stedene til Leds og nummer det. Vis også retningen for datastrømmen i neopiksel -lysdiodene. Siden jeg bruker to strimler, i pin nummer 8 og 9, har jeg nummerert det som 8 _ _ og 9 _, der det første tallet er pin -nr og resten er nummerering av LED. Noen ord som "A QUARTER" og "TWENTY FIVE" er for lange, og jeg bestemte meg for å bruke to lysdioder der. Også navnet hennes skulle være det levende, så jeg brukte 4 lysdioder der. For andre detaljer kan du se malen min. Jeg har lagt ved svg -filen til malen min. Få den skrevet ut og sjekk om den er perfekt i størrelsen ved å holde den over vinylen du har skrevet ut i transparenter.
Lag en eske på 8 x 8 tommer i hardboardet med en blyant som forlater like store avstander fra kanten av hardboardet på alle de fire sidene. Husk hardboardet er 9 x 9 tommer og malen er 8 x 8 tommer. Fest malen i hardboard med papirlim i esken du tegnet.
Klipp LED -stripene individuelt og bruk det dobbeltsidige båndet på baksiden for å feste den i posisjonene til lysdioder i malen din. Jeg hadde bare 30 lysdioder i stripene, men jeg trengte 4 til. Jeg hadde også 20 lysdioder av samme type. Så jeg brukte 4 av dem, lagde min egen modul ved å legge til kondensatorer og stikke den i en papp med varmt lim og bruke den i ordet "Sneha".
Etter at alle lysdioder sitter fast, lag 6 hull ved siden av hver led, 3 på venstre side og 3 på høyre side. Jeg brukte en hammer og en spiker av passende størrelse for å lage hull. Sørg for at hullene er individuelle fra hverandre, ellers vil ledninger bli kortsluttet etter lodding. Etter det får du din 0,75 kvm solide ledning, fjern enden og før den gjennom hullene og lodd den til lysdiodene. Ikke glem at lysdioder vendes i hver alternative rad. Vær spesielt oppmerksom på pilen for datastrømretning mens du lodder. Behold alle ledningene på baksiden av hardboardet fordi vi må legge til papp etterpå for å unngå fargeblødning. Når det gjelder fargeblødning, kutter jeg den hvite pappa med en bredde på 25 mm etter å ha målt lengden som kreves. Jeg brukte varmt lim for å få det til å stå stille, og det fungerer veldig bra. Steder hvor jeg ikke kan bruke varmt lim, brukte jeg papirlim, men det tar over en natt å tørke. Så, velg med omhu.
Løsning for for smale steder for en LED til å passe inn: For bokstaver som "I" og hjertet som er for smalt til å passe til en LED, stikker jeg LEDen der med bare LED på toppen av bokstaven og andre overflødige deler utenfor den. Jeg holder kartongen over de overflødige delene. Det spiller ingen rolle. Likevel var det et problem mens du stakk lysdioder i "hjertet". Det var en ledning til ved siden av den, på grunn av hvilken ideen min ikke var anvendelig der. For å løse det bestemte jeg meg for å lage den ledningen aller siste, slik at jeg også kan kutte den høyre delen av ledningen, da jeg ikke trenger å overføre flere data (siden det ikke er noen Leds etter den). Se bildet jeg har lagt til.
For tre bokstaver som "ONE" eller "TWO" klippet jeg en spalte, bøyde PCB -en av ledningen og førte den gjennom på baksiden av hardboardet. Det er rart jeg vet, men det fungerer. Det var en idé av en venn av meg. Men ikke gjør det overalt, bare steder der det er nødvendig.
Trinn 7: Sett alt sammen
Etter at alt er gjort, var det tid for montering.
Gå og hent et 9 x 9 tommers glass til esken din. Fest den til esken med hva du vil, jeg brukte varmt lim. Fest deretter vinylen til glasset med superlim veldig forsiktig. Sett kretskortet innvendig, men ikke fikse det. Påfør strøm, tenne noen lysdioder, gi litt trykk på hardboardet med hånden og sjekk om det er på linje med vinyl. Hvis ikke, må du arkivere hardboardet fra hvilken som helst av de fire sidene for å redusere størrelsen. Ta deg god tid med justeringsprosessen.
Etter at det er gjort, fikser du hardboardet. Legg til potensiometer og likestrømkontakt. For å gi strøm til alle komponentene, brukte jeg et stykke PCB, loddet to solide ledninger (Vcc og GND) og brukte dem som strømforsyningsskinne. Etter det loddet jeg alle komponentene til dem for å bruke strøm. Jeg brukte Vin pin av arduinoen for å gi den kraft.
Gjør alle forbindelsene til arduino, og nyt ordklokken din.
Et råd, stikk en svart tape bak dummyord, det vil hjelpe mye å redusere fargeblødning. Bytt også ut DS3231 3.3V batteri med et nytt.
Eventuelle spørsmål, vennligst kommenter.
Takk skal du ha:)
Anbefalt:
DIY -- Hvordan lage en edderkopprobot som kan kontrolleres ved hjelp av smarttelefon ved hjelp av Arduino Uno: 6 trinn
DIY || Hvordan lage en edderkopprobot som kan kontrolleres ved hjelp av smarttelefon ved hjelp av Arduino Uno: Mens du lager en edderkopprobot, kan du lære så mange ting om robotikk. Som å lage roboter er både underholdende og utfordrende. I denne videoen skal vi vise deg hvordan du lager en Spider -robot, som vi kan bruke ved hjelp av smarttelefonen vår (Androi
Ordklokke: 21 trinn (med bilder)
Word Clock: Nok en gang den populære ordklokken. Drevet av en arduino -klon og WS2812B -lysdioder, ble designet først inspirert av dette eksemplet, deretter skrev jeg om fastvaren som inneholder noen ideer fra dette instruerbare ved hjelp av fastled -biblioteket. Mine mål for
Ordklokke kontrollert av 114 servoer: 14 trinn (med bilder)
Ordklokke kontrollert av 114 servoer: Hva har 114 lysdioder og kjører alltid? Som du kanskje vet er svaret et ordklokke. Hva har 114 lysdioder + 114 servoer og beveger seg alltid? Svaret er denne servokontrollerte ordklokken. For dette prosjektet gikk jeg sammen med en venn av meg som snudde
Hvordan lage en drone ved hjelp av Arduino UNO - Lag en quadcopter ved hjelp av mikrokontroller: 8 trinn (med bilder)
Hvordan lage en drone ved hjelp av Arduino UNO | Lag en Quadcopter ved hjelp av mikrokontroller: Introduksjon Besøk min Youtube -kanal En Drone er en veldig dyr gadget (produkt) å kjøpe. I dette innlegget skal jeg diskutere hvordan jeg får det billig? Og hvordan kan du lage din egen slik til en billig pris … Vel, i India er alle materialer (motorer, ESCer
Lage en klokke med M5stick C ved hjelp av Arduino IDE - RTC sanntidsklokke med M5stack M5stick-C: 4 trinn
Lage en klokke med M5stick C ved hjelp av Arduino IDE | RTC sanntidsklokke med M5stack M5stick-C: Hei folkens i denne instruksen vil vi lære å lage en klokke med m5stick-C utviklingsbord av m5stack ved hjelp av Arduino IDE. Så m5stick vil vise dato, tid og amp; uke i måneden på displayet